Safety Compliance: Ensure strict adherence to all safety regulations, codes, and standards related to grid and transmission line construction.
Risk Assessment: Conduct regular risk assessments to identify potential hazards and develop strategies to mitigate them.
Safety Training: Organize and provide safety training programs for employees and contractors, ensuring they are equipped with the necessary knowledge and skills.
Incident Reporting: Establish and oversee a system for reporting and investigating accidents, near misses, and safety violations.
Safety Inspections: Conduct routine safety inspections at construction sites to identify and rectify safety issues promptly.
Emergency Response: Develop and maintain emergency response plans and coordinate drills to ensure preparedness.
Documentation: Maintain comprehensive records of safety-related incidents, inspections, and training.
Safety Culture: Foster a safety-first culture within the organization, encouraging all employees to actively participate in safety initiatives.
Regulatory Compliance: Stay up-to-date with local, state, and federal safety regulations, and ensure compliance.
Safety Equipment: Ensure that all safety equipment is in good working condition and readily available to employees.
Reporting: Prepare regular safety reports for management, highlighting key performance indicators and areas for improvement.
